Here is additional information, how IBus works: At the first time you start IBus, it load a keyboard layout from xkb settings, not from localectl (for mainly console). This is because a keyboard layout might specified many places such as Plasma's system settings, lightdm, some custom scripts in ~/. On the other hand, once a layout is loaded to IBus, the layout is saved to IBus's configuration and the layout is loaded regardless of layouts specified in the other places. This is expected behavior. See also: https://bugzilla.opensuse.org/show_bug.cgi?id=1101736 To revert the layout to system specified layout, there are several ways: - Uninstalling IBus - Adding the system layout to IBus with ibus-setup - Disabling IBus's layout switcher with ibus-setup I just compared two environment (Leap and Tumbleweed) - 1.5.22: xkb:de::ger - 1.5.23: xkb:de::deu (manually added, YaST add one with nodeadkeys) I will check the code to understand how difference of ger and deu behaves. Just one small additional data point: the binary zoom package also has a dependency on ibus, indicating why this package might be installed on many openSUSE machines. $ wget https://d11yldzmag5yn.cloudfront.net/prod/5.3.472687.1012/zoom_openSUSE_x86_64.rpm $ rpm -qpR ~/Downloads/zoom_openSUSE_x86_64.rpm [skip] ibus ibus-m17n [skip] Between 1.5.22 and 1.5.23, some keyboard layouts including xkb:de::ger have been changed. So while upgrading IBus, since old layout name in its configuration DB is unknown for the newer IBus, it cannot load that layout end fall back to en layout. For now, users have to manually add xkb:de::deu (or what they want) from ibus-setup. https://github.com/ibus/ibus/commit/ed7bc8dcded59fb391687e3e9b0676c77accf736#diff-ed9f6f25068608efd412958da4dfc19328ca3511251fa6d5f9c42baf230e32f8 https://github.com/ibus/ibus/issues/2153 (In reply to Fuminobu Takeyama from comment #35) > Between 1.5.22 and 1.5.23, some keyboard layouts including xkb:de::ger have > been changed. So while upgrading IBus, since old layout name in its > configuration DB is unknown for the newer IBus, it cannot load that layout > end fall back to en layout. > > For now, users have to manually add xkb:de::deu (or what they want) from > ibus-setup. Is it not possible to do migration there? Current IBus does not provide such migration feature. I opened an issue in the upstream project. https://github.com/ibus/ibus/issues/2274 In the next upstream version, it will show a warning message when a deprecated layout is detected and IBus will replace it with English one. https://github.com/ibus/ibus/issues/2274 IBus 1.5.24 is on a way to Tumbleweed https://build.opensuse.org/request/show/874459 Additional note: As far as I compared an old and the current XML file, renamed (removed) layouts include be:*:ger, ch:*:ger, de:*:ger, gr:*:gre, ro:*:rum, and, sk:*:slo. openSUSE Leap 15.3 will be shipped with IBus 1.5.23.
